High year-to-date counts exceeding 1,100 confirmed U.S. tornadoes as of mid-August 2026—well above the 1991–2020 climatological average of roughly 1,000–1,200 annually—drive the 85.5% market-implied probability for a 1,250+ total. Illinois alone has surpassed 200 confirmed tornadoes, shattering prior state records amid persistent atmospheric conditions featuring enhanced low-level moisture, wind shear, and mesoscale convective systems that fueled multiple spring and early-summer outbreaks. NOAA and SPC data show this elevated activity extending typical seasonal patterns, with August–December historically adding 200–400 more tornadoes. While model consensus and jet-stream variability introduce some uncertainty for late-year counts, current observational trends and historical analogs position totals comfortably above 1,250 absent an abrupt reversal to below-average conditions.

Only tornadoes appearing in the final NCEI dataset for all months of 2026 will count.
As of market creation, the December report is not yet scheduled, however the release schedule can be found here: https://www.ncei.noaa.gov/access/monitoring/dyk/monthly-releases. The market will resolve based on the first relevant tornado count published on the NCEI tornado time-series page after this scheduled release time.
If the value published after this scheduled release time is labeled preliminary, it will still determine resolution, and the market will resolve independently of any subsequent revisions, corrections, or retroactive adjustments.
The market will not resolve based on any preliminary values published before the scheduled release time.
If no data is published by the scheduled release time, or if the NCEI website is temporarily unavailable, this market will remain open until that data is made available. If the relevant data is not made available by the date of the next scheduled publication ET, this market will resolve based on available data for the most recent prior month. If the NCEI website becomes permanently unavailable, this market will resolve using another credible source.
